Overview

Stewart & Stevenson is Now Hiring a Diesel Truck Shop Technician II at 2301 Central E Fwy, Wichita Falls, TX 76302 .

Responsible for diagnosing problems and performing standard mechanical repairs in a shop environment on customer's equipment including trucks, buses, engines, engine components, and subassemblies.

Responsibilities

  • Accurately troubleshoot and diagnose standard problems with customer's equipment.
  • Identify and order parts necessary to complete repairs and routine maintenance.
  • Perform standard repairs on customer's equipment. Replace parts and equipment as necessary.
  • Perform routine maintenance on equipment according to established guidelines and schedules.
  • Complete all work orders and time sheets in a legible, accurate and timely manner.
  • Provide assistance to more senior level Shop Technicians on larger jobs.
  • Maintain a clean and safe work environment.
  • Perform all work in accordance with established quality standards and safety procedures.


Qualifications

  • Ability to utilize the available time to organize and complete work within given deadlines.
  • Ability to communicate in writing clearly and concisely.
  • Ability to communicate effectively with others using the spoken word.
  • Ability to take care of the customers' needs while following company procedures.
  • Ability to utilize laptop computers and portable diagnostic tools required.
  • The trait of being dependable and trustworthy.

Education/Experience:

High School Diploma or General Education Degree (GED) and two to four years related experience required.

Computer Skills:

Basic computer navigation and utilization skills required.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ications (Word, Excel, Outlook) preferred.

Certificates & Licenses:

Technical certification in automotive and/or diesel engine repair required.
